BOLDENED Meaning and Definition

  1. Boldened is the past participle of the verb "bolden," which means to make something more pronounced, emphasized, or emphasized in a bold or daring manner. This term is often used to describe actions or statements that are intentionally made more prominent or noticeable, often with the aim of attracting attention or making an impact.

    When something is boldened, it usually means that it has been highlighted or intensified in some way to make it stand out from its surroundings. This can be done through the use of bold font, colors, or other visual cues that draw the eye to the specific element. In addition, it can also refer to a figurative emphasis, where an idea or point is stated with more force or conviction to draw attention and leave a lasting impression.

    The concept of boldened can be applied in various contexts. In a written document, it can refer to the act of making important words or phrases stand out through formatting techniques. In a spoken conversation, it can describe the action of speaking more assertively or confidently to capture the listener's attention. It can also be used metaphorically when discussing personal growth or taking daring actions to overcome challenges.

    Overall, boldened describes the act of intensifying or drawing attention to something in a bold or noticeable manner, whether through visual cues or through a confident and assertive demeanor.

Etymology of BOLDENED

The word "boldened" is formed by adding the suffix "-en" to the adjective "bold". The adjective "bold" derives from the Old English word "beald" meaning "brave" or "courageous". It has Germanic origins and is related to the Middle Dutch word "boud" and the German word "bald". The suffix "-en" is a verbal suffix used to transform an adjective into a verb, indicating the act of making or becoming bold.
